Output 2c07ec068107ac311ba94b29010d6a96dd51a1cada09a16df9d6cf1bfca95d06:9

value
435765
script pubkey
OP_0 OP_PUSHBYTES_20 3a45389721e6e92016ae8b4acc99829dd960ecfe
address
bc1q8fzn39epum5jq94w3d9vexvznhvkpm87mcw80r
transaction
2c07ec068107ac311ba94b29010d6a96dd51a1cada09a16df9d6cf1bfca95d06
spent
true